With the advent of NXT 2.0, WWE has signed several new talents to go along with their new vision. This included the company signing the Usos’ real-life brother Joseph Fatu.

Joseph Fatu also happened to make his debut on this week’s episode of NXT 2.0 and to commemorate the occasion, WWE released a short vignette. The company also registered a trademark on Joseph Fatu’s new NXT 2.0 name, Solo Sikoa.

The vignette revealed that he will now go by the name Solo Sikoa as it also provided some background for his character in order for fans to get familiarized with.

“You won’t find my wins and losses in any record books, those live on the streets. I was left to fight alone when I was 15 years old, and that’s when I became Solo Sikoa. Street Champion, of the Island.”
